Output 3f39c3a68d7cfe38e155da941d3af792a858a30477ca2824ef57986127e1904f:2

value
145539691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 290838a76c2fe273c71309d01b7d36e70c4567b2 OP_EQUAL
address
35RyUdncAZzgyQWjbBpENkQMNi65fxRAAa
transaction
3f39c3a68d7cfe38e155da941d3af792a858a30477ca2824ef57986127e1904f
spent
true